Turnover Ratio.

The turnover ratio is a measure of how much of a mutual fund’s holdings are traded in a given year. It is calculated by dividing the value of the fund’s trades by the fund’s total assets. What is unfair competition?

The concept of unfair competition is used to refer to the behavior of any professional or employer that is contrary to the requirements of good faith.
